After much deliberation, I have decided it is time to say goodbye my Maserati 4200 Cambiocorsa and change to a different sports car. Over the past 3 years she has been simply the best, most exciting, most heart racing car I have ever owned. Every time you drive it is really is an event.

I have cared for it without regard to cost and loved every second of ownership. I spent a lot of time finding a great example before buying, the car has always felt tight and sharp. It drives like it should do, like the day it rolled out if the factory.

Being a 2004 car, it has had the mechanical revisions but not the facelift bumpers. For many, this is the ideal mix, keeping the classic looks but with an improved car.

The car is also in a rare and beautiful colour, Blu Sebring. That combined with the beige interior is the classic Maserati colour combination.

It has just been serviced at well known specialist, Autoshield Maserati, and so is ready to go to a new home with nothing to do.

The car is in excellent condition. There is only the odd stone chip and a few car park dings, but that's it. Everything that needed doing has been done throughout its entire history, as evidenced by the extremely extensive service history.

Service history as follows
6,490 miles - Graypaul
13,750 miles - Graypaul
18,640 miles - Graypaul
22,912 miles - Graypaul
26,700 miles - Graypaul
30,700 miles - Kent High Performance (The Ferrari Centre)
39,360 miles - Charles Ivey
47,500 miles - Maranello
49,871 miles - Maranello (V-belt changed)
51,600 miles - Autoshield (£2.5k completely all fluids, all lower shock bushes, rear tie rods, front track rods)
53,865 miles - Autoshield (£2k new front lower wishbone)
